Hungarian Pol Who Wrote Law Banning Same-Sex Marriage Busted At “Orgy” In Brussels Gay Nightclub

Vice News reports:

A politician from Hungary’s ruling party has apologised for breaking COVID lockdown restrictions in Belgium to attend what local media reported was a full-blown orgy. József Szájer, a longtime representative of Hungarian Prime Minister Viktor Orbán’s Fidesz party, unexpectedly quit as a member of the European Parliament (MEP) on Sunday.

On Tuesday, it was reported in Belgium that police had broken up a sex party involving 25 people above a bar in the centre of Brussels, only several hundred metres from the Belgian capital’s main police station. The media reports about the Brussels orgy on Friday said that most of the participants were men.

Szájer reportedly tried to evade police by climbing out of window and when captured, attempted to claim diplomatic immunity. Drugs were found at the scene.
